Brett Hull is a National Hockey League Hall of Fame inductee (2009) and son of Bobby Hull, also a member of the NHL Hall of Fame (1983). He's currently the Executive Vice President for the St. Louis Blues, the team for which he still holds the high scoring record (527) from when he played there between 1987 and 1998. An avid golfer, Hull often said during his hockey playing days that he preferred golf to hockey. He was ranked by Golf Digest Magazine in 2009 as the sixth best athlete/golfer in all of North America. Golf Gear for Today’s Player

It's unclear who exactly invented the game of golf or when. Some say it was the Dutch, as early as the 13th century, when sticks and leather balls were used. In 1360 the game was actually banned in Brussels by the City Council, where the penalty for playing was set at 20 shillings or the loss of one's overcoat!

There seems little doubt, however, that the game as we know it today, played on a course over 18 holes, was started in Scotland. It was called "gouf," a Scottish translation of the Dutch word "colf," which means stick or club. Again the game was officially banned, this time by Scottish Parliament in 1457, because it was thought to interfere with time that should be spent in the practice of archery. Proficiency at archery was seen as a necessity for military purposes. Golf was described as "an unprofitable sport."

When you think back 500 years, not much has changed. Golf gained popularity across the British Isles starting in the late 19th century and became what is still known as a "Gentleman's Game." Specific rules were initiated and a certain standard of golfing attire adopted. Today, most of those rules still apply and, believe it or not, "appropriate" clothing worn on the course has seen little change for decades.
